Product Overview
The refined WOWNOVA 8.8″ PC Temp Monitor & Sensor Display offers an all-in-one secondary screen that plugs directly into a motherboard USB header or USB-C port. With a slim aluminum housing and an IPS panel, the unit measures 9.33″×2.64″ and supports a vivid 1920×480 resolution. It functions as a dedicated hardware sensor panel, reporting CPU & GPU temperatures, RAM and HDD usage, FPS, and more without tying up HDMI ports or GPU outputs. The bundled Turzx software provides a library of preset dynamic themes and a visual editor for custom layouts. Power and data travel over a single cable—no external power adapter is required—making installation clean and unobtrusive. The package includes mounting brackets for 120mm or 140mm fans, 3M adhesive tape, and a 32 GB flash card. Continuous theme updates and customer support are promised, though user reports note occasional access difficulties. Overall, the product sets out to streamline PC monitoring, combining professional sensor readouts with customizable dynamic visuals in a compact secondary display.

WOWNOVA 8.8″ PC Temp Monitor Review: Honest Findings
After analyzing dozens of user testimonials, the WOWNOVA panel shines for its plug-and-play convenience. Unlike HDMI-based “dashboard” screens, it requires only one USB-C or 9-pin header cable, eliminating extra adapters. Reviewers consistently note that colors are bright and the IPS viewing angles remain accurate within a PC case. The included Turzx software delivers over 20 prebuilt themes in both vertical and horizontal formats; with a single click, stats jump to the display. Custom theme creation is markedly simpler than Rainmeter or AIDA64 skinning, with drag-and-drop placement and live data preview. Build quality earns praise, as does the thin profile that tucks neatly behind a windowed side panel. However, some users report that the native software doesn’t sleep with the PC, leaving the panel lit when the system is off unless managed manually or via third-party tools. Early adopters experienced broken download links, but printed instructions in the box now point to updated URLs. Overall, real-world testing reveals a blend of robust hardware paired with an evolving software ecosystem—excellent for those willing to navigate minor quirks.

Negative Reviews & Rumor Analysis
While the hardware generally satisfies users, the software and support draw criticism. Multiple buyers report that Turzx downloads from the company’s Google Drive links were initially broken or flagged by antivirus tools, requiring VPN workarounds or alternate sources. Themes sometimes fail to scale correctly, and the editor can be glitched—users describe difficulty importing custom GIFs or videos beyond 16:9 crop limitations. A few early units were DOA or exhibited intermittent power-off issues, forcing motherboard USB re-seating. Despite promises of continuous updates, some forum posts indicate months-long stalls on bug fixes and feature requests. No credible rumor of fire, data breach or scam emerged—negative commentary centers on perceived overpricing at $140 versus a fair market of $70–100, and poor documentation in English. A small subset was disappointed by non-24-hour time formats and missing sleep-mode integration. Customer service responses can be slow, with unanswered support tickets. In summary, serious complaints are limited to software stability and logistical support rather than hardware safety or fraudulent claims.
